This was the third consecutive meeting between the two teams in the final phase of a European Championship, with the Czech Republic celebrating the same number of victories.
In a wonderful atmosphere created by three and a half thousand spectators in the stands in Pavilion P at the exhibition center, the Czech volleyball players entered the European Championship in Brno victoriously. Despite faltering in the second set, they defeated Greece 3:1, which is a good springboard for them to continue the championship this weekend. On Saturday, they will play against Austria.
The Czech volleyball team entered the European Championship victorious. In Brno, they defeated Greece 3:1 in the opening group B match, with the scores 25:14, 23:25, 25:15 and 25:20.
